Output 881fc6b0ab9258c9d128789e5225bdbacb64353b78558ef69466652c973fe877:8

value
41840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9bf560a3cc1fea30e9f0fd90bf7be2e6812a0e OP_EQUAL
address
3QoyiGFhmbMHPCzGrjtgJ6WZUVFPdEjKEP
transaction
881fc6b0ab9258c9d128789e5225bdbacb64353b78558ef69466652c973fe877
spent
true